@Entity
@Table(name="JPA21_ADDRESS")
@NamedStoredProcedureQueries({
@NamedStoredProcedureQuery(
name = "ReadAllAddressesWithNoResultClass",
procedureName = "Read_All_Addresses"
),
@NamedStoredProcedureQuery(
name = "ReadNoAddresses",
procedureName = "Read_No_Addresses"
),
@NamedStoredProcedureQuery(
name = "ReadAddressWithResultClass",
resultClasses = org.eclipse.persistence.testing.models.jpa21.advanced.Address.class,
procedureName = "Read_Address",
parameters = {
@StoredProcedureParameter(mode=IN, name="address_id_v", type=Integer.class)
}
),
@NamedStoredProcedureQuery(
name = "ReadAddressMappedNamedFieldResult",
resultSetMappings = "address-field-result-map-named",
procedureName = "Read_Address_Mapped_Named",
parameters = {
@StoredProcedureParameter(mode=IN, name="address_id_v", type=Integer.class)
}
),
@NamedStoredProcedureQuery(
name = "ReadAddressMappedNumberedFieldResult",
resultSetMappings = "address-field-result-map-numbered",
procedureName = "Read_Address_Mapped_Numbered",
parameters = {
@StoredProcedureParameter(mode=IN, type=Integer.class)
}
),
@NamedStoredProcedureQuery(
name = "ReadAddressMappedNamedColumnResult",
resultSetMappings = "address-column-result-map",
procedureName = "Read_Address_Mapped_Named",
parameters = {
@StoredProcedureParameter(mode=IN, name="address_id_v", type=Integer.class)
}
)
})
@SqlResultSetMappings({
@SqlResultSetMapping(
name = "address-field-result-map-named",
entities = {
@EntityResult(
entityClass = Address.class,
fields = {
@FieldResult(name="id", column="address_id_v"),
@FieldResult(name="street", column="street_v"),
@FieldResult(name="city", column="city_v"),
@FieldResult(name="country", column="country_v"),
@FieldResult(name="province", column="province_v"),
@FieldResult(name="postalCode", column="p_code_v")
}
)
}),
@SqlResultSetMapping(
name = "address-field-result-map-numbered",
entities = {
@EntityResult(
entityClass = Address.class,
fields = {
@FieldResult(name="id", column="1"),
@FieldResult(name="street", column="2"),
@FieldResult(name="city", column="3"),
@FieldResult(name="country", column="4"),
@FieldResult(name="province", column="5"),
@FieldResult(name="postalCode", column="6")
}
)
}),
@SqlResultSetMapping(
name = "address-column-result-map",
columns = {
@ColumnResult(name = "address_id_v"),
@ColumnResult(name = "street_v"),
@ColumnResult(name = "city_v"),
@ColumnResult(name = "country_v"),
@ColumnResult(name = "province_v"),
@ColumnResult(name = "p_code_v")
})
})
